Job Description

Support student learning and classroom management as a paraprofessional in a K-12 school setting. This contract position in Cambridge, MA, offers the opportunity to assist educators in creating an engaging and supportive environment that fosters student success throughout the school year.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ide classroom support to teachers by working with individual students and small groups
  • Assist with instructional activities, reinforcing lesson content and helping students stay on task
  • Support students with diverse learning needs, including those requiring additional assistance
  • Monitor student behavior and promote a positive and respectful classroom atmosphere
  • Help prepare materials and organize learning resources as directed by the teacher
  • Communicate effectively with teachers and school staff regarding student progress and needs

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Previous experience as a paraprofessional or related educational role is preferred
  • Ability to work effectively with students from kindergarten through 12th grade
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
  • Patience, flexibility, and a genuine interest in supporting students academic growth
  • Familiarity with common classroom activities and instructional support techniques
